- They have only ever
played eight gigs, but on
Saturday night, Cambridge band My
Friend Irma appeared on
the same bill as two of Britain's
top soul bands.
-
- My Friend Irma were
the winners of the Walden Rock
Competition last week and part of
the first prize was supporting
Odyssey and The Real Thing at the
Carnival Final Night Party on
Saturday.
|
-
|
- "I
can hardly believe we are going to play a
gig with Odyssey," said singer Jenni
after winning the competition.
-
- Earlier
this year the band which was formed only
last November, won the audience vote in
the Cambridge Band Competition at The
Junction.
- However,
according to My Friend Irma, the Walden
event beats its Cambridge rival hands
down.
-
- "The
Competition in Saffron Walden has been so
much fun," said Jenni. "It's
been a great atmosphere and much more
friendly than at Cambridge. We are really
delighted to have won."
-
- Although
most of the crowd at the rock competition
final seemed to be rooting for The Ha
Ha's as the only Walden entry, My Friend
Irma proved to be a popular winner.
-
- This
band oozed energy and excitement with
commercial, catchy dance music. In
addition to Jenni, the line up included
Tom on guitar and vocals; Tim on bass;
Dave on drums and John on guitar who was
standing in for Guy who writes most of
the band's music but was away on
holiday...
